Claw Them Into Shape is a quest available in Dragon's Dogma II.

Walkthrough[]
[1] Quest begins when speaking with Beren at his tent, which is located in Northern Vermund at the base of Mt. Alles. He will assign two tasks to the Arisen:
- Bring him some weapons, 3 swords to be exact.
- Locate a motivated soldier to train.
[2] Obtain 3 Swords:
Swords can be obtained at the Borderwatch Outpost (which is cheapest) or in Vernworth when seeking out the ideal candidate in step 3. If this quest is on the back burner or while taking on other endeavours, other shops can be visited while traveling around other regions and towns, some peddlers that travel from place to place also sell swords, but may be much more expensive.
[3] Recruit a Motivated Soldier:
The ideal candidate is Humphrey, who is located in Vernworth. He can generally be found near the portcrystal that resides in the center of the city. Speak with Humphrey and recommend he join forces with Beren.
[4] With swords purchased and Humphrey recruited, return and speak with Beren. He will then ask the Arisen to spar with him at the Borderwatch Outpost.
[5] Spar with Beren:
Two outcomes can occur, although either outcome ends in the same result- the Arisen earns Beren's respect. There however is a difference in Beren's dialog, depending on if the Arisen wins or losses:
- Besting Beren:
- To best Beren, the Arisen must knock him out of bounce or deplete his energy a second time. (verify)
- Beren's reaction/dialog when winning: "That was well fought. You're e'en stronger than I'd anticipated."
- Losing to Beren:
- Beren knocks the Arisen out of bounds. Beren can easily send the Arisen flying a great distance with his powerful warrior-style attacks.
- Beren's reaction/dialog when losing: "Hm. Seems I expected o'er much of you."
Note: Additional sparring dialog will take place if the Arisen is capable of depleting a good portion of Beren's energy. To do so, both Beren and the Arisen cannot be knocked out of bounce.

Following the sparring session, Eli will arrive and request that Beren "must come, and quickly!"
[5] Follow Eli and Beren as they investigate the troubled site of a recent attack by goblins and a cyclops. The incident will lead to Beren's dismissal as an instructor, culminating in the completion of the quest.
